Best Applied Psychology Colleges in India: Admissions 2025
The general eligibility criteria for admission to the best Applied Psychology colleges in India are mentioned below:
- UG: The candidate should have completed their class 12 from a recognized board and secured a minimum of 50% marks.
- PG: The candidate should have completed their graduation in any discipline and secured a minimum of 55% aggregate marks. It is preferable if students have completed their undergraduate in Applied Psychology or some other relevant course.

The admission procedure for Applied Psychology distance courses admission is basically the same as that of a regular institute. Students will have to first fill up the admission application form of the University, using their official website. They typically ask for personal details, id-proof and a nominal application fees.
The colleges prepare and release the list of selected candidates. The list is usually based on merit or entrance exam scores. Once this list is released, students can pay the application fees to confirm their admission and start their academic journey.

No, it is not necessary for a student to study Psychology in 12th if they want to study BA Applied Psychology courses. Students from all streams and academic backgrounds can study BA Applied Psychology if they have completed their class 12th from a recognised board, with at least 45% marks.
All students can pursue the BA Applied Psychology course if they wish to study about the Psychological theories and apply those theories to real-world applications, to help a company/oranization grow.

Yes, an Arts student can pursue Applied Psychology courses. As per the basic eligibility for Applied Psychology courses, a candidate from any stream in Class 12 can apply for the course. Candidates are advised to refer to the marks criteria for admission in Applied Psychology courses. Applied Psychology is available as a specialisation in various Arts and Science courses at undergraduate and postgraduate levels. One can also study Applied Psychology courses as a specialisation in PG Diploma and also can pursue a PhD in Applied Psychology.
